
无论是初创企业还是大型机构,保护数据的安全性和完整性,确保业务连续性,都是不可忽视的核心任务
随着云计算技术的飞速发展,越来越多的企业选择将数据库迁移到云端,以享受其弹性扩展、成本效益高以及易于管理等优势
然而,云端环境同样面临着数据丢失、损坏或被非法访问的风险
因此,在CentOS环境下实施有效的云数据库备份策略,对于维护数据安全和业务稳定至关重要
一、为何备份云数据库至关重要 1.灾难恢复能力:自然灾害、硬件故障、人为错误或恶意攻击都可能导致数据丢失
定期备份可以确保在发生意外时,能够迅速恢复数据,减少业务中断时间
2.数据合规性:许多行业和地区对数据保护有严格规定,如GDPR(欧盟通用数据保护条例)等
定期备份并妥善管理备份数据,是符合法律法规要求的关键步骤
3.版本控制:在开发或测试过程中,可能需要回滚到之前的数据库状态
良好的备份机制能够提供不同时间点的数据快照,便于版本管理和数据回溯
4.性能优化:定期备份还可以帮助识别和优化数据库性能瓶颈,通过分析备份数据,可以发现数据增长趋势,为资源规划提供依据
二、CentOS环境下的云数据库备份策略 在CentOS操作系统中,备份云数据库需要综合考虑备份工具的选择、备份频率、存储位置、加密与安全性等多个方面
以下是一套综合策略: 1. 选择合适的备份工具 - mysqldump:对于MySQL或MariaDB数据库,`mysqldump`是一个简单而有效的命令行工具,可以导出数据库的结构和数据
虽然适合小规模数据库,但在处理大型数据库时可能效率较低
- Percona XtraBackup:作为开源的热备份解决方案,Percona XtraBackup支持在线备份,即在备份过程中数据库仍可提供服务,大大减少了备份对业务的影响
- 云服务商提供的备份服务:大多数云数据库服务(如AWS RDS、Azure Database for MySQL、Google Cloud SQL等)都内置了自动备份功能,用户可以根据需要配置备份频率和保留周期
2. 制定备份计划 - 定期备份:根据数据变化频率和业务重要性,设定每日、每周或每月的备份计划
对于关键业务数据,建议实施每日增量备份和每周全量备份的组合策略
- 差异化备份:在增量备份的基础上,仅备份自上次备份以来发生变化的数据块,可以大幅减少备份时间和存储空间需求
- 测试备份恢复:定期执行备份恢复测试,确保备份数据的有效性和恢复流程的顺畅,避免在真正需要时才发现问题
3. 存储与加密 - 多地点存储:将备份数据存储在多个地理位置,以防止单一地点的灾难导致数据丢失
利用云存储服务(如Amazon S3、Google Cloud Storage)可以轻松实现这一点
- 加密备份:无论备份数据存储在何处,都应使用强加密算法(如AES-256)进行加密,确保即使备份数据被盗,也无法被轻易解密
4. 自动化与监控 - 自动化备份流程:利用脚本或编排工具(如Ansible、Terraform)自动化备份任务,减少人为错误,提高工作效率
- 监控与报警:实施监控机制,跟踪备份任务的状态,一旦检测到失败或异常,立即触发报警,确保及时响应和处理
三、最佳实践与注意事项 - 备份窗口选择:尽量在非高峰期进行备份,减少对业务性能的影响
对于在线业务,可考虑使用热备份工具或云服务的自动备份功能
- 备份数据保留策略:根据数据重要性和法规要求,制定合理的备份数据保留期限
过期的备份应及时删除,以节省存储空间
- 权限管理:严格控制备份数据的访问权限,确保只有授权人员能够访问和操作备份数据,防止内部泄露
- 文档记录:详细记录备份流程、存储位置、加密密钥等重要信息,并建立知识库,便于团队成员查阅和操作
- 灾难恢复演练:定期进行灾难恢复演练,验证备份数据的可用性和恢复流程的可行性,提升团队的应急响应能力
四、结论 在CentOS环境下实施云数据库备份策略,是保障企业数据安全、提升业务连续性的关键措施
通过选择合适的备份工具、制定科学的备份计划、加强存储与加密管理、实现自动化与监控,可以有效降低数据丢失风险,确保数据在任何情况下都能迅速恢复
同时,持续的优化与演练,将进一步提升备份策略的有效性和团队的应急处理能力
在这个数据驱动的时代,确保数据的安全与可用性,是企业持续发展和创新的重要基石
数据库单表备份全攻略
CentOS云数据库高效备份指南
MC服务器数据守护:高效备份文件管理与恢复指南
主备服务器协同,确保数据安全无忧
Linux下高效备份大量MySQL数据库技巧
SQL2008单表数据备份实用指南
企业备份软件排行:精选Top榜单
数据库单表备份全攻略
Linux下高效备份大量MySQL数据库技巧
CentOS系统数据库文件备份指南
手机全数据库备份指南
APP开发:数据库备份恢复全攻略
ISC数据库备份简易指南
腾讯云数据库:高效备份服务器指南
C服务器自动化MySQL数据库备份指南
数据库关键备份策略揭秘
U8财务数据库备份全攻略
数据库备份:掌握全局增量策略
旺铺助手数据库备份教程